TONY HOLT & THE WILDWOOD VALLEY BOYS (Indiana)
Rebel Records recording artists, Tony Holt & The Wildwood Valley Boys have become a favorite in bluegrass music. Originally formed in 1992 and currently features Tony Holt, Jesse Baker, Greg Moore, Tom Patrick, Brad Lambert, and Tony's dad, Aubrey Holt, from the legendary "Boys from Indiana".

The SPBGMA (Society for the Preservation of Bluegrass Music of America) inducted singer-songwriter Aubrey Holt into its Preservation Hall of Greats. Some may remember Aubrey from the band "The Boys From Indiana". Aubrey is one of the most renowned songwriters in bluegrass music today with songs recorded by artists such as The Grascals, Alison Krauss, Blue Highway, Longview, Cherryholmes, and many others. His song “The Sad Wind Sighs” recorded by The Grascals, with Vince Gill, was nominated for “Recorded Event of the Year” at the 2009 IBMA Awards. His songs "Atlanta Is Burning" and "Listen to My Hammer Ring" are bluegrass standards. And in 2010 he was nominated for BLUEGRASS SONGWRITER OF THE YEAR at the 36th Annual SPBGMA Bluegrass Music Awards in Nashville.
